Transaction 34844ecddf927206e837f437305ca8fdae6489c606859930075aad50463000e7
1 Input
1 Output
-
34844ecddf927206e837f437305ca8fdae6489c606859930075aad50463000e7:0
- value
- 15996928
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d795dfbb5e7ce1d0150cd07cf2a57fb2d844ad3 OP_EQUAL
- address
- 38kfM3s2nS9wdju6wHqnrQHbenY3ZNQK7M